
Munich Carnival will take place from May 27, 2027 to May 30, 2027.
Munich Carnival is celebrated in Munich, Germany.
Munich Carnival is a Caribbean-style summer carnival festival held annually in Munich, Germany. The event brings together Soca, Dancehall, and Afro-Caribbean music with vibrant European summer energy, creating a four-day celebration centered around music, culture, and community. Unlike traditional German carnival celebrations, Munich Carnival focuses on contemporary Caribbean influences and a modern party-driven atmosphere.
The festival attracts attendees from across Europe and beyond, offering a curated carnival experience that blends themed nightlife events, dance workshops, rooftop day parties, and a Road March through the city. With music trucks, DJs, and a multicultural crowd, Munich Carnival has established itself as a growing fixture on the European summer carnival calendar.
Munich Carnival offers a weekend of Caribbean music, themed events, and a lively street parade experience. Attendees can expect a mix of Soca and Dancehall soundtracks, rooftop daytime celebrations, interactive workshops, and high-energy night parties. The weekend builds toward Sunday’s Road March, which brings carnival spirit through the streets of Munich before concluding with a final closing afterparty.
The Road March is the centerpiece of the weekend, bringing music and carnival energy through central Munich. Participants gather to wave flags, dance behind music trucks, and celebrate Caribbean culture in the heart of the city.
Dance workshops focused on Soca and Dancehall provide attendees with an opportunity to engage with Caribbean movement and music before the evening celebrations begin.
Soca and Dancehall are at the heart of the weekend, with DJs delivering high-energy sets that bring island rhythms to the streets of Munich. This emphasis on Caribbean sounds gives the event a distinct identity compared to many European carnivals.
Signature themed events, including an all-white night party and rooftop celebrations, form an essential part of the Munich Carnival experience, combining music, style, and nightlife.

The best areas to stay for Munich Carnival 2026 are Altstadt (Old Town) and Maxvorstadt — both put you within easy walking distance of Wittelsbacherplatz where the parade begins, with Marienplatz, beer halls, and the main Carnival route all on your doorstep.

Explore the historic charm of Marienplatz and the Glockenspiel, relax in the expansive Englischer Garten, or tour the grand Nymphenburg Palace for a glimpse into Bavaria’s royal past. Visit Viktualienmarkt for local bites and fresh produce, or dive into automotive history at the BMW Museum. If you have extra time, take an easy day trip to Neuschwanstein Castle or nearby Salzburg, Austria.
